## Changelog — MatchCore 4.2.1

Changed defaults to reduce garbage-collection pauses in the matching service. Previous settings allowed the old generation to grow until full pauses exceeded our pairing-latency budget during evening peaks. We now cap heap growth, enable incremental collection, and shorten the young-generation cycle. On-call: expect slightly higher steady-state CPU but no pauses above 150 ms. If pauses recur, compare live values against these new defaults.

service settings:
PRAIX_LOG_LEVEL=error
PRAIX_METRICS_HOST=metrics.praix.qorvelcorp.corp
PRAIX_POOL_SIZE=16

# Env file — Cartwheel dispatch, driver-assignment heuristic
# Scope: staging only. Do not promote to prod.
# The heuristic weights (proximity, shift balance, refusal rate) are tuned
# for the Velmont pilot region and will misbehave elsewhere.
# Review notes: heuristic service runs unprivileged; it reads weights
# read-only from the tuning store and writes nothing back.
# Only one sensitive value exists in this file: the tuning-store access
# credential, consumed at boot and never logged.
# That credential is set on the following line.

secret setting of faduf-bahop: LEDGER_TOKEN8=c3b363be

### Running the string extractor

Welcome to the Lexiform team. Our extraction script, `pullstrings`, scans the Ostara app's source tree for translatable text and pushes new entries to the Lexiform catalog service. Run it from the repo root after every UI change; it is idempotent, so repeated runs are safe. The script needs network access to the catalog's staging instance and will fail loudly if authentication is missing. Before your first run, export the internal catalog key, which is provided directly below.

app token of bawep-hafog = kto7_vwrmnlx

**Q: Where do we work while Larkspur House is being renovated?**

Until the refurb wraps up, everyone's decamped to the temporary site at Fennel Court, third floor. Same desks policy, same kitchen rules, slightly worse coffee. Your regular badge won't work on the Fennel Court doors, though — you'll need the temporary pass code below.

door code, yagap-bahof: bdg-O-05